Buy Me a Coffee

AI Agent自動編寫代碼並修復程式Bug - SWE-Agent

在這個AI狂熱的時代,程式設計師可以利用各種工具來提升生產力和簡化工作流程。最新的 SWE-Agent 就是一個令人興奮的新工具,它能夠自動檢測和修復GitHub上開源專案的程式Bug,並自動提交Pull Request!

GitHub網址:https://github.com/princeton-nlp/SWE-agent

SWE-Agent 簡介

SWE-Agent是由普林斯頓大學的團隊開發的一個AI代理,它利用大型語言模型(LLM)來理解和修復程式碼。它的核心特點是能夠自動:

  • 複製GitHub Issue中描述的Bug
  • 瀏覽程式碼庫並找到受影響的檔案
  • 編寫修復Bug的程式碼
  • 提交Pull Request將修復合併到原始碼庫

根據開發團隊的說法,SWE-Agent在修復開源程式Bug的表現幾乎可以媲美人類開發人員。這無疑將大大提高軟體開發的效率和品質。